Charles Coote, 1st Earl of Mountrath

Charles Coote, 1st Earl of Mountrath (c. 1610 – 17 December 1661) was an Irish peer, the son of Sir Charles Coote, 1st Baronet, and Dorothea Cuffe, the former being a veteran of the Battle of Kinsale (1601) who subsequently settled in Ireland.
==Irish Rebellion and Civil War==
The younger Coote became an MP for Leitrim in the Irish Parliament between 1634 and 1635 and again in 1640, a year before the outbreak of the Irish rebellion of 1641. The elder Charles Coote was active in the suppression of the Irish insurgents in 1642, launching attacks on Clontarf and County Wicklow in late 1641 in which many civilians died; he was killed in action defending Trim in May 1642.
After the death of his father, Charles Coote also led some of the King's forces under Ormonde against the Confederate army, but was captured defending a stronghold in the Curragh of Kildare by an Irish army led by Castlehaven. He was released during the 1643 cessation of arms.
At this time Coote travelled to England with a number of Protestants to agitate for harsh anti-Catholic measures and an end to the cessation. In Dublin Archbishop Ussher condemned the extremism of Coote and his fellows, but Coote was unbending. The King, however, ignored these demands and so Coote joined the Parliamentarians.〔Meehan, Confederation of Kilkenny,pg 101〕 Coote was appointed commander of Connaught by the Parliamentarians in 1645. Operating from west Ulster, he temporarily overran the north-west of the province over the next two years.
